Rental Market Trends

Madison County, NY

As of June 2025, Madison County's rental market is compet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units. Madison County's average rent is 51.7% ($1,183) lower than the New York average of $2,287 and 38.1% ($680) lower than the U.S. average of $1,784.

Madison County Rental Market FAQs

Explore rental prices, market trends, and availability in Madison County, NY.

The average rent in Madison County, NY is $1,104 per month.
Homes in Madison County typically rent for between $693 and $1,710 per month, with an average of $1,104 per month.
In Madison County, the average rent for a 1-bedroom home is $990 per month, for a 2-bedroom home, $1,135 per month, and a 3-bedroom home is $1,315 per month.
The average rent in Madison County is 38.1% ($680) lower than the national average of $1,784 per month.
The average rent in Madison County has decreased by 10.0% ($122) in the last month and increased by 7.7% ($79) over the past year.
The rental market in Madison County, NY, is currently compet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units.
In Madison County, NY, the average rental stays on the market for approximately 39 days. While most properties are rented within this timeframe, factors like seasonality, demand, and property type can affect how quickly a rental leases.
There are currently 6 rental properties available in Madison County, NY.
Based on the current averages, a household would need an annual income of $45,400 to comfortably afford a 2-bedroom home in Madison County.
